What happened
The attack caused an IT shutdown and halted global manufacturing operations, including JLR's major UK plants. Dealer systems were intermittently unavailable, while suppliers faced cancelled or delayed orders and uncertainty about future demand.
Production stopped on 1 September and remained halted for five weeks. The disruption spread far beyond JLR because its manufacturing model depends on a tightly connected network of suppliers, logistics providers and technology systems.
The Cyber Monitoring Centre estimated the total economic damage at £1.9 billion, with more than 5,000 organisations affected. The precise attack vector was not publicly confirmed in the authoritative sources used for this page.

The root cause
A cyberattack creates the same operational problem as other third-party incidents: critical software and systems become unavailable. The cause differs from insolvency, acquisition or discontinuation, but the operational outcome is similar.
The JLR event showed how deeply one organisation's disruption can propagate through an integrated supply chain. Suppliers can stop even when they are not the direct target because shared portals, ordering systems and manufacturing connections are unavailable.

The regulatory consequence
The JLR incident focused attention on supply-chain technology risk across the UK and EU. NIS2 extends cybersecurity obligations into supply chains, while DORA requires incident response and recovery testing for critical ICT dependencies. UK guidance also emphasises supply-chain cyber-risk management.
